Premier Appoints Deputy Minister of Economic and Rural Development and Tourism
Premier Darrell Dexter today, Jan. 12, announced the appointment of Simon d'Entremont as deputy minister of Economic and Rural Development and Tourism.
Mr. d'Entremont, a native of West Pubnico, has more than 15 years experience working for the federal government. He was regional director general in the Atlantic region for Health Canada and regional director at Industry Canada, Atlantic region. He has also held a number of positions with the Atlantic Canada Opportunities Agency. He began his career in the private sector as stock broker with Scotia McLeod Inc.

Mr. d'Entremont will begin in his new position Jan. 23. He replaces Sandra McKenzie, who was appointed deputy minister of Labour and Advanced Education.
